I'm trying to install Planet CCRMA on my FC4 installation, but I've 
gotten only so far as the kernel upgrade, and the sound driver doesn't work.

Here's what I get when I boot into the new kernel (ver. no. in error 
message below) and try to restart alsasound:

[root@localhost /]# /etc/init.d/alsasound restart
Shutting down sound driver                                 [  OK  ]
Starting sound driver snd-via82xx FATAL: Error inserting snd_via82xx 
(/lib/modules/2.6.12-0.21.rdt.rhfc4.ccrma/updates/pci/snd-via82xx.ko): 
Unknown symbol in module, or unknown parameter (see dmesg)
                                                           [FAILED]

I see a similar message during the boot-up sequence, but it flashes by 
so quickly I haven't been able to write down the exact message.  It's 
something to the same effect, though.

Also, KDE complains when I start it up, saying it can't initialize the 
sound driver, but I'm guessing that's a secondary problem that will go 
away if I fix the main problem with the sound module.

What should be my next step in trouble-shooting?
